    Am trying to get a W2K server box on ESX 3.5 U2. It fails at 97%; updating boot sector.

    I have run Converter locally and from another machine with the same result.

    I have tried to convert it to ESX and VMware server, same result.

    What a pain! I finally got this converted by running VMware Converter from another machine and converting it as a VMware Server Virtual Machine. Then I started the VMware Server virtual machine and ran VMware Converter on it to convert it to ESX, which was very sloooowww, and it actually hung at 97%, but in this case I was able to start the ESX virtual machine anyway.

    It might have been easier for me to do a clean w2k install and then restore from an NT backup or some type of ghosting scheme...

    An interesting postscript to this whole ordeal was that when I went into computer management/disk management I found that Dell Open Manage was installed and I could not access the disks. I think this was, possibly, causing the problems with the disk creation. I removed that program, rebooted and was able to add the missing data volume and restore the original data from NT backup. I also deleted the UPS software....
